CaYN3 is a calcium yttrium nitride ceramic compound, a member of the rare-earth nitride family that combines alkaline-earth and lanthanide elements with nitrogen. This is primarily a research material under investigation for high-temperature structural applications and advanced ceramic coatings, where its thermal stability and potential hardness could offer advantages over conventional nitride ceramics. The material remains experimental; its development is driven by the search for improved refractory and wear-resistant ceramics for extreme environments where traditional materials reach performance limits.
